refresh

热门公司

Trending

招聘

JobsAmazon

Software Development Engineer II, Books Purchase & Payments Experience

Amazon

Software Development Engineer II, Books Purchase & Payments Experience

Amazon

Chennai, TN, IND

·

On-site

·

Full-time

·

2w ago

We are seeking a Software Development Engineer with a passion for innovating on behalf of e Book customers to simplify e Book purchases and Kindle subscriptions. You will build innovative experiences that reduce transaction friction and create extensible solutions for digital purchase experiences that can be leveraged across multiple digital businesses.

This role offers a unique opportunity to collaborate across services, design and propose new architectures or modify existing ones, and drive the right technical trade-offs between short-term and long-term concerns. You will navigate significant complexity while building features that require changes across various services and pages, including e Books purchase and store experiences for digital products. The complexity extends further as these features must be scalable and work seamlessly across multiple digital businesses and surfaces, including PC Web Browser, Mobile Web browser, Amazon Android application, Free Kindle reading apps on iOS and Android, and Amazon's E-reader devices.

  • Key job responsibilities
  • As a member of the team, you will spend your time as a hands-on engineer and a technical leader who takes ownership of business/technical problem end to end.
  • You will play a key role in defining the architecture for software using a wide range of technologies, programming languages and systems.
  • You will be given the freedom to explore your own ideas with the reward of seeing your code raise the bar for millions of Amazon customers worldwide, including your own family and friends.
  • You will interface with product manager & stakeholders to understand the business requirements.
  • You will author detailed design covering process/data flow diagrams, key trade-offs, technology & cost considerations that you will review with your team’s SDEs/Sr. SDEs as well as impacted upstream/downstream interface SDEs/Sr. SDEs to incorporate feedback resulting in well thought out high quality designs.
  • You will engage in design reviews within team as well as within org with aim of providing feedback to elevate the quality of designs.
  • You will engage in various team ceremonies like code reviews, daily standup, sprint planning, backlog grooming, sprint retros, operational excellence hand-offs.
  • You will actively engage in operational support for your team, and ensure that the root causes of operational issues are identified and resolved.
  • You don’t settle for the status quo, and routinely identify and execute on opportunities to improve your team’s operations.
  • We embrace the challenges of a fast paced market and evolving technologies and making decisions to provide the best buying experience to our customers.
  • You will be encouraged to see the big picture, be innovative, and positively impact millions of customers.
  • Successful candidates for this position will have a background in Java or C++. Equally important to these specific skills is a candidate's ability to multi-task, adapt quickly to new development environments and changing business requirements, learn new systems, gain new skills, create reliable & maintainable code, and find creative, scalable solutions to difficult problems.
  • The ability to communicate clearly and concisely both written and orally is a key competency as is demonstrable skill as a self-starter.
  • We are looking for candidates who are passionate about delivering consistently to our customers, particularly those who want to grow within a world-class engineering team.

About the team
Our team owns the customer purchase experience for a-la-carte e Books and Kindle Unlimited subscription and related business metrics (e.g., Purchase Success Rate) across all surfaces (Small, Medium, Large and Kindle E-readers) globally. Purchase experience is a holistic view of all Books customer interactions in their journey between intent to buy or subscribe through receipt of their digital product. We enable simplified purchasing CX, new payment methods and products, expand access to new customers and protect customer trust by meeting all regulatory and compliance demands. Our vision is to enable a zero-friction purchase experience, offering all payment methods for Books customers worldwide on any surface

Basic Qualifications

  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ture (design patterns, reliability and scaling) of new and existing systems experience
  • 3+ years of computer science fundamentals (object-oriented design, data structures, algorithm design, problem solving and complexity analysis) experience
  • 2+ years of server-side development experience
  • 3+ years of programming with at least one software programming language experience

Preferred Qualifications

  • 3+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ience
  • Bachelor's degree in computer science or equivalent

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process, including support for the interview or onboarding process, please visit https://amazon.jobs/content/en/how-we-hire/accommodations for more information. If the country/region you’re applying in isn’t listed, please contact your Recruiting Partner.

Total Views

0

Apply Clicks

0

Mock Applicants

0

Scraps

0

About Amazon

Amazon

Amazon

Public

Amazon.com, Inc. is an American multinational technology company engaged in e-commerce, cloud computing, online advertising, digital streaming, and artificial intelligence.

10,001+

Employees

Seattle

Headquarters

Reviews

2.9

10 reviews

Work Life Balance

2.8

Compensation

3.7

Culture

2.5

Career

2.3

Management

2.1

35%

Recommend to a Friend

Pros

Good pay and compensation

Strong benefits package

Flexible scheduling options

Cons

Poor management and leadership

Limited growth and promotion opportunities

High stress and demanding work environment

Salary Ranges

2 data points

L2

L3

L4

L5

L6

L2 · Data Analyst L2

0 reports

$108,330

total / year

Base

$43,332

Stock

$54,165

Bonus

$10,833

$75,831

$140,829

Interview Experience

10 interviews

Difficulty

3.7

/ 5

Duration

21-35 weeks

Offer Rate

20%

Experience

Positive 10%

Neutral 10%

Negative 80%

Interview Process

1

Application Review

2

Recruiter Screen

3

Online Assessment

4

Technical Phone Screen

5

Onsite/Virtual Loop

6

Team Matching

7

Offer

Common Questions

Coding/Algorithm

System Design

Behavioral/STAR

Leadership Principles

Technical Knowledge